Introducing Claude: A Next-Generation AI Assistant
In the world of artificial intelligence, there are various models and systems that aim to assist humans in different tasks. One such model is Claude, a cutting-edge, high-performance AI assistant developed by Anthropic. However, Anthropic has also introduced a lighter, more affordable, and faster option called Claude Instant. Both versions of Claude are built on Anthropic's research on AI system training that focuses on usefulness, honesty, and harmlessness.
What sets Claude apart is its versatility in performing various conversation and text processing tasks, all while maintaining a high level of stability and predictability. Users can access Claude through a chat interface in the developer console or via API, making it easily accessible for developers and individuals looking for AI assistance.
Now, let's shift our focus to the concept-based education and classroom teaching. One of the key aspects of concept-based education is fostering conceptual understanding among students. To achieve this, teachers need to go beyond simply repeating knowledge that can be readily found on the internet. Instead, they should encourage students to think critically and engage with complex ideas that require conceptual lenses.
In a classroom setting, the teacher plays a crucial role in guiding students towards conceptual understanding. By posing thought-provoking questions and providing opportunities for students to explore and explain their ideas, teachers can help students develop their thinking skills at a conceptual level. This approach goes beyond mere factual knowledge and functional abilities, ultimately leading to a deeper understanding of big ideas or concepts.
To design and implement this conceptual understanding element in classroom teaching, teachers can utilize conceptual lenses. Conceptual lenses are ideas or concepts that act as focal points in learning, adding depth and richness to the educational experience. In the book "Thinking Classrooms: Concept-Based Curriculum and Instruction," several examples of conceptual lenses are provided, including conflict, beliefs/values, interdependence, freedom, identity, relationships, change, perspective, power, systems, structure/function, design, heroism, strength, complexity, paradox, interaction, transformation, regularity, origin, revolution, reform, influence, balance, innovation, genius, utility, and creativity.
By incorporating these conceptual lenses into their teaching, educators can guide students towards a deeper understanding of various subjects. For example, exploring the concept of interdependence can help students see the interconnectedness of different phenomena and systems. Analyzing the concept of power can shed light on the dynamics of authority and influence in society. By using conceptual lenses, teachers can expand the horizons of their students' thinking and encourage them to explore beyond surface-level knowledge.
To enhance the effectiveness of concept-based education and classroom teaching, here are three actionable pieces of advice:
-
Encourage inquiry-based learning: Instead of spoon-feeding information to students, create an environment that promotes curiosity and encourages students to ask questions. Foster a sense of wonder and guide students towards seeking answers independently.
-
Foster collaboration and discussion: Provide opportunities for students to engage in meaningful discussions and collaborative activities. By sharing their ideas and perspectives, students can deepen their understanding of concepts and learn from each other's insights.
-
Use real-world examples and applications: Connect concepts to real-life situations and show students how they apply in practical scenarios. This approach helps students see the relevance and applicability of concepts, making their learning more meaningful and engaging.
